Parents are reacting after a Miami Lakes teacher was taken into custody on a fugitive warrant out of North Carolina.

Jordan Hawk, 26, was teaching her social studies class at the Miami Lakes K-8 Center when authorities arrested her on Tuesday.

“Good morning ma’am, you have an arrest warrant from North Carolina,” said Judge Mindy S. Glazer during Hawk’s court appearance, Wednesday.

Hawk is accused of inappropriate conduct with a student in North Carolina.

“Felony indecent liberties with a minor, four counts,” said Glazer.

According to police, Hawk was a teacher at the time at Kannapolis Middle School, north of Charlotte.

The grandmother of one of the alleged victims discovered the disturbing behavior after finding love letters addressed to her grandson.
